Hybrid heat pump water heaters use a storage tank, so they're sized in gallons by household — but because they recover heat efficiently, a 50-gallon hybrid often serves a home that needed a 65–80 gallon electric tank.

Winter is when tanks fail most, because cold incoming water and heavy demand push an aging unit past its limit — right when everyone needs an emergency replacement at emergency prices. Swap it proactively in a slower month instead.

Editors' roundtable

Tank or tankless — and what should you budget?

What a water heater costs to install and what it costs to run rarely move together, and the format is the lever between them. Tank, tankless, and heat-pump each strike that balance differently.

The simple-swap case

When money is the constraint and the existing tank has kept up with the household, dropping in the same fuel type and capacity is the least disruptive move. No venting rework, no new gas line, no panel space to find — a plumber can pull the old unit and set the new one before lunch.

The tankless case

The tankless premium buys longevity and endless supply: nothing sitting hot around the clock, a lifespan roughly double a tank's, and no cold showers when demand spikes. The catch lives in the setup, since most retrofits need a bigger gas line or an electrical upgrade first. Larger households planning to stay put recover that cost fastest.

The heat-pump case

For the lowest running cost of the three, the heat-pump water heater wins outright, and where utilities offer incentives the rebates behind it are the richest available. You pay for that advantage up front, and the unit needs the right home — a warm, well-ventilated area with real clearance. Wedge it into a tight closet and the savings disappear.

Our take

The right format depends on how long you're staying and what you're optimizing for: upfront cost favors tank, convenience favors tankless, and long-run savings favor heat-pump.
